I have an EEP which used to work in v7.6 but is giving me an error in v9.

I have Traced and R:Styled endlessly this morning but to no avail - there just 
doesn't seem to be anything wrong and I have run out of ideas of what else to 
look for.

The first error message is the usual Endwhile, Endsw or Endif missing in input 
file (462)
After clearing that I get what seems contradictory: No While, Switch or If 
blocks are open on current input source (466)

This is the relevant block of code:


  -- 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
  -- Return the parameters back to the form to build the menu:
  -- 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
  PROPERTY IDGB_EnterChoices VISIBLE 'FALSE'
  PROPERTY IDGB_ChoiceMade   VISIBLE 'TRUE'

  SWITCH (.vNameTitle)  -- fails on pressing [F10] on this line?
    CASE 'Name'
      PROPERTY RBID_NameTitle ENABLED 'FALSE'
      PROPERTY RBID_NameType  ENABLED 'FALSE'
      PROPERTY RBID_TitleType ENABLED 'FALSE'
      PROPERTY RBID_SortName  ENABLED 'TRUE'
      PROPERTY RBID_SortTitle ENABLED 'FALSE'
      PROPERTY VID_vSelName   ENABLED 'TRUE'
      BREAK
    CASE 'Title'
      PROPERTY RBID_NameTitle ENABLED 'FALSE'
      PROPERTY RBID_NameType  ENABLED 'FALSE'
      PROPERTY RBID_TitleType ENABLED 'FALSE'
      PROPERTY RBID_SortName  ENABLED 'FALSE'
      PROPERTY VID_vSelName   ENABLED 'FALSE'
      IF vTitleType = 'TrackTitle' THEN
        PROPERTY RBID_SortTitle ENABLED 'FALSE'
          ELSE
        PROPERTY RBID_SortTitle ENABLED 'TRUE'
      ENDIF
      BREAK
  ENDSW

  PROPERTY TABLE Temp_MCM_Table   'REFRESH'
  PROPERTY CID_vSelId ENABLED     'TRUE'
  PROPERTY CID_vSelId SET_FOCUS   'TRUE'
  PROPERTY CID_vSelId REFRESHLIST 'TRUE'
  PROPERTY CID_vSelId LISTOPEN    'TRUE'
  PROPERTY IDI_Image  SET_FOCUS   'TRUE'
  RETURN


Anybody got any ideas whatmay be going on?
